First of all, thank you for your hard work. Fanaleds adds a lot of functionality that is not available anywhere else!

I was playing Simraceway 2 weeks ago with Fanaleds working just fine (installed as directed, in the plug-in directory), then suddenly this week, I stopped getting any display or RPM indicators within the game. I have a Clubsport wheel... and the displays work in rFactor (1 & 2).

I have not changed anything... It was working just a 2 weeks ago on the same configuration, but Simraceway automatically updates every few days.

I tried running Fanaleds as administrator and still get no display.

I'm running Windows 8, which does cause some minor issues launching events within the Simraceway UI, but once I'm racing, it runs very stable.

Someone else on the Simraceway forum is also having this issue.

Apparently Simraceway is only letting "approved" plug-ins work with their system. Any chance of you working with them to make this happen? LEDs work with the Logitech G27 wheel and the SRW-S1 wheel, but they don't require a plug-in.
